Westosha Central's Liam Lubkeman's perfect shooting led the team to a victory over Waterford, securing second place in the Southern Lakes Conference with a 77-63 win.

By the Numbers
  • Liam Lubkeman went a perfect 10 for 10 from the field, scoring 21 points.
  • Central finished the regular season 11-3, securing second place in the Southern Lakes Conference.
